The Cave Art Paintings of the Lascaux Cave

    http://www.bradshawfoundation.com/lascaux/
    Among the most famous images are four huge, black bulls or aurochs in the Hall of the Bulls. One of the bulls is 17 feet (5.2 m) long - the largest animal discovered so far in cave art.
